Iguana Mia
Walking into Iguana Mia, you'll find a casual, family-friendly spot serving Mexican staples. This Southwest Florida original opened in Cape Coral in 1990 and expanded to Fort Myers in 1993, earning the 2020 Best Mexican Restaurant in Lee County honor from Gulf Shore Life. The full bar and happy hour make it a popular neighborhood choice. You can make reservations, and there's outdoor seating when the weather's right. Reviewers note the drinks are great and service is accommodating, though waits can happen. Owner Dirk Atherton and executive chef Julian Prieto still oversee operations, keeping recipes solid since day one.
